Joanna Wicherek studied piano, chamber music, historical keyboards and organ in Warsaw (Frederic Chopin Music University), Freiburg (Musikhochschule Freiburg) and Vienna (Universität für Musik und darstellende Kunst). She performs internationally an extensive repertoire with an emphasis on modern classical music. She also has a profound understanding of Historically Informed Performance and specialist knowledge of historical keyboard instruments. Wicherek professionally collaborates with Poland’s most important composers Paweł Mykietyn, Paweł Szymański and Sławmor Kupczak. Her recordings include a CD with the early music ensemble Proavitus (2003) and Paweł Szymański's music on the soundtrack to the film Violated Letters (2010). Wicherek has been awarded several prizes including the Standard Bank Ovation Award at the National Arts Festival, South Africa (2014), Grand Prix at the Competition of the 20th and 21st Centuries for Young Performers, Warsaw and the International Competition of Contemporary Chamber Music, Krakow. Joanna is a Young Artist of a prestigious Accademia Villa Bossi in Italy. From 2014 to 2017 she resided in South Africa where she was active as a concert pianist and and piano pedagogue.
